What happens when you tell the cops to f**k off

Stop the ACLU has a YouTube video of an incident at the UCLA library in which an Arab student refused to produce his school ID when asked by campus police. The ID checks are routine at that time of night so the student, Mostafa Tabatabainejad, was not being singled out.

After being told repeatedly to stand up by the officers Mr. Tabatabainejad said "f**k you" to the cops and continued to refuse to cooperate. The police, after warning Tabatabainejad that they would use a Taser on him if he didn't comply with their instructions Tasered him.
